This essay "The Concept of Latchkey Children" focuses on the term latchkey child that was coined during World War II.... With at least one parent at war, the other was forced to find a job, leaving children to come home to empty houses, apartments, and tenements.... .... ... ... The child left home alone was forced to open the latch with a key, thus the terminology latchkey children....
